Job overview
The Instructor - Youth Sports role at South Shore YMCA involves planning and executing youth sports programs, particularly volleyball, while ensuring a safe and engaging environment for participants.
Responsibilities and impact
Daily responsibilities include leading youth volleyball programs, supervising activities, providing member service, maintaining facility safety, and supporting community engagement efforts.
Experience and skills
Candidates should be at least 16 years old, have experience working with children, knowledge of volleyball, and certifications in CPR/AED and First Aid are preferred.

Company overview
South Shore YMCA is a nonprofit organization dedicated to fostering youth development, healthy living, and social responsibility within the South Shore community of Massachusetts. It operates through a variety of programs, including fitness and wellness services, childcare, educational initiatives, and community outreach, generating revenue through membership fees, program participation, and charitable donations. Established in 1892, it has a long history of serving the community, emphasizing inclusivity and personal growth.
